and how did you get theta=2 radians? :S
When you worked out r in terms of P that gave the max area in (iii), you get r = P/4 (4r = P).

But P= r(theta + 2), from (i)

4r = r(theta + 2)
4 = theta + 2
theta = 2.


I didn't even realise you could use part (i) to work it out. I forget exactly how i did it, but i used the equation for the area in (ii) and another equation and ended up with theta = 2 anyways but it just took longer.
